Transaction 2d76e526cef2563f9c3284e2e9f9e96bf8e727cf7557144c79f5c8aed17c8027
1 Input
2 Outputs
- 2d76e526cef2563f9c3284e2e9f9e96bf8e727cf7557144c79f5c8aed17c8027:0
- 2d76e526cef2563f9c3284e2e9f9e96bf8e727cf7557144c79f5c8aed17c8027:1
value 536113
address 1BWd8Njapi6CYegQbhMHjBNppPjWaPKAQJ
value 5183239
address 16S4xTd44eM3bLdJZxXpHTL8Z2jdkPRFyy